Outdoor School Program Coordinator
Want to turn outdoor education into a full time career? Nature’s Classroom New England is looking for Program Coordinators to join our administrative team!
Nature’s Classroom New England is the largest overnight, hands-on, nature/science/SEL based outdoor education program in the northeast. We provide programming for thousands of elementary and middle school students across New England each year!
Each spring and fall we host students at our 6 beautiful sites. During their 1-5 day stay, students participate in an exciting variety of day and night time activities, facilitated by Nature’s Classroom instructors.
Program Coordinator responsibilities include:
- Oversee all day-to-day operations and programming at your site.
- Manage, supervise, and support a staff of 8 - 15 instructors.
- Create and maintain a positive relationship with your host site.
- Participating in our bi-annual Program Coordinator training programs.
- Run a comprehensive instructor training week at the beginning of each season
- Create a positive and professional work culture.
- Build and maintain strong relationships with schools.
- Provide consistent and ongoing communication with each school. This includes traveling to schools to run informational meetings during the winter months.
- Perform all administrative duties (eg. creating schedules, writing group reports, managing a site budget, etc).
This is a full time position with 10 weeks unpaid each summer. During those 10 weeks, Program Coordinators may choose to work a summer job, or take some time off.
Start Date
ASAP
Salary and Benefits
Starting salary is $900 per week.
Health Insurance, dental insurance, and vision insurance are available.
Location
Yarmouth Port, MA
Housing and Accommodations
Housing will be provided at your host site during the fall and spring seasons. Winter housing is also available upon request. Food is provided when schools are on site. A communal staff kitchen and food stipend are available on weekends and when schools are not on site.

Requirements
Experience and Qualifications
- At least one year of management experience.
- At least five years experience working with youth.
- At least three years experience working in an outdoor setting (summer camp or outdoor education preferred).
- Ability to work with gmail, google drive, and CRMs, and be able to produce accurate and professional written and verbal communications (i.e. emails and phone calls).
- Ability to quickly get to remote locations on camp property over uneven terrain.
- A passion for outdoor education!
